Gobble Gobble! Chatham Turkey Trot to Benefit Fire Dept., Diabetes Research

Seventh annual event to waddle through town on Nov. 26.

It’s time to stretch this wings and thighs and get those feathers flapping: The annual Chatham Turkey Trot is set for Thanksgiving Day.

The seventh annual event is set for 8:30 a.m. on Thursday, Nov. 26, and will benefit the Chatham Township Volunteer Fire Department and Diabetes Research Institute. Anyone registering before 5 p.m. Nov. 16 can enter for $15 per person and receive a t-shirt. Registrants on race day will cost $25.

The one-mile race will weave its way through The Highlands section of the township. Over the past seven years, the event has raised more than $60,000.

Registration and warm-ups begin at 8 a.m. with the one-mile family fun run at 8:30 a.m. The USA Track & Field Certified 5K Race will begin at 9 a.m., followed by an award ceremony at 9:50 a.m.
